EFGM: Evolution and Applications With Respect To Fracture Problems
Details
The work aims to provide a comparative study of various procedures that define the Element-free Galerkin method(EFGM) and the modifications or alterations that took place to improve the workability of EFGM. Every part of EFG process has been described in a different chapter and conclusions are provided in the end to help readers comprehend the improvements and alterations in the process. The book covers all the important literature works related to the analysis of fracture problems using EFGM.
